We are after some interactive whiteboard pens for the whiteboards we have on-site. We have Hitachi Cambridge (All different version numbers)

I have found that sourcing pens for this board has become pretty difficult as Hitachi have discontinued the pen. The pen was a very light shade of grey with blue buttons, quite big in size.

We have Smart Boards in our primary school, so don't have this issue there

 

We managed to get some rechargeable pens working with them, which work pretty well, but its the cost that's the problem. For a pack of two with the charger it costs around £150! And as you know what teachers are like, once they are lost, well they are truly lost.

Have told them many of times - We have started charging departments for replacement pens and for some reason the amount of helpdesk jobs for pens has dropped!

But still ridiculous how much they cost for what they are. Have been looking into touch screen plasma screens as replacements, which has worked well for our primary school

It's 20-25 year old tech, and the only market are teachers who have lost their pens. While I have paid less for them in the past, there are clearly enough people willing to pay the current price to make it worthwhile to continue to manufacture them.

 

If they were £30 I'd buy 200 tomorrow. But they aren't so we won't.

 

(I should add that the pens need new chargers, so one you have jutted out the site with new pens/chargers at £117 per room, any lost pens will only cost £35 to replace in the future.)
